Outline of Final Research Achievements

To elucidate the maturation control mechanisms in non-climacteric grape fruits, we performed metabolome analysis of metabolites (especially plant hormones) and transcriptome analysis (RNA-Seq) of comprehensive gene expression using fruits with different maturation phenotypes. The results suggested that there is crosstalk between various plant hormones during the grape fruit maturation process, and abscisic acid (ABA) plays an important role in maturation. The progression patterns of coloration varied greatly between varieties, were related to fluctuations in endogenous ABA content, and these traits were suggested to be heritable. Additionally, it was suggested that at least part of the ABA in the fruits may have been translocated from other tissues.
